【python根据出生日期获得年龄的方法】教程文章相关的互联网学习教程文章

Python爬虫正则表达式常用符号和方法

正则表达式并不是Python的一部分。正则表达式是用于处理字符串的强大工具,拥有自己独特的语法以及一个独立的处理引擎,效率上可能不如str自带的方法,但功能十分强大。得益于这一点,在提供了正则表达式的语言里,正则表达式的语法都是一样的,区别只在于不同的编程语言实现支持的语法数量不同;但不用担心,不被支持的语法通常是不常用的部分。 1、常用符号 . :匹配任意字符,换行符 \n 除外 :匹配前一个字符0次或无限次 ? :匹...

讲解Python 中删除文件的几种方法【代码】【图】

很多时候开发者需要删除文件。可能是他错误地创建了文件,或者不再需要该文件。无论出于何种原因,都有一些方法可以通过Python来删除文件,而无需手动查找文件并通过UI交互来进行删除操作。(免费学习推荐:python视频教程)使用Python删除文件有多种方法,但是最好的方法如下:os.remove()删除文件os.unlink()删除文件。它是remove()方法的Unix名称。shutil.rmtree()删除目录及其下面所有内容。pathlib.Path.unlink()在...

python求绝对值的方法有哪些【图】

python求绝对值的方法:1、条件判断方法;2、内置函数【abs()】方法;3、内置模块【math.fabs】方法;其中【abs()】是一个内置函数,而【fabs()】在math模块中定义的。本教程操作环境:windows7系统、python3.9版,DELL G3电脑。python求绝对值的方法:1、条件判断2、内置函数abs()3、内置模块 math.fabsabs() 与fabs()的区别abs()是一个内置函数,而fabs()在math模块中定义的。fabs()函数只适用于float和integer类型,而abs()也适...

字典的什么方法返回字典的键列表【代码】【图】

在Python中,字典的keys()方法可以返回字典的“键”列表,语法格式为“dict.keys()”。keys()方法会以列表返回一个字典所有的键。本教程操作环境:windows7系统、Python2版、Dell G3电脑。Python 字典(Dictionary) keys()方法keys()方法以列表返回一个字典所有的键。语法:dict.keys()返回值:返回一个字典所有的键。示例:#!/usr/bin/python dict = {Name: Zara, Age: 7} print "Value : %s" % dict.keys()以上实例输出结果为:V...

Python介绍 list.sort方法和内置函数sorted【代码】【图】

相关免费学习推荐:python视频教程Python列表排序 list.sort方法和内置函数sorted很多时候我们获取到一个列表后,这个列表并不满足我们的需求,我们需要的是一个有特殊顺序的列表.这时候就可以使用list.sort方法和内置函数sorted,本文就是介绍list.sort方法和sorted内置函数的使用方法和区别.一、list.sort方法list.sort方法会就地排序列表,也就是说不会把原列表复制一份。这也是这个方法的返回值是None的原因,提醒您本方法不会新建...

Python简单地实现一键提取阴阳师原画方法【代码】【图】

免费学习推荐:python视频教程xpath–简单的爬虫实例–提取阴阳师原画壁纸文章目录一、前言二、需要用到的库三、实现过程1、分析网页2、完整代码实现四、合成视频一、前言很多人都玩过阴阳师吧,别的不谈,阴阳师的原画制作的那是相当地精细,闲暇之余,用几行简单的代码爬取下来,岂不美哉?二、需要用到的库import requestsfrom lxml import etreefrom fake_useragent import UserAgentimport os没用安装库的小伙伴,可以看一下我...

介绍python 数据抓取三种方法【代码】【图】

免费学习推荐:python视频教程三种数据抓取的方法正则表达式(re库)BeautifulSoup(bs4)lxml*利用之前构建的下载网页函数,获取目标网页的html,我们以https://guojiadiqu.bmcx.com/AFG__guojiayudiqu/为例,获取html。from get_html import downloadurl = https://guojiadiqu.bmcx.com/AFG__guojiayudiqu/page_content = download(url)*假设我们需要爬取该网页中的国家名称和概况,我们依次使用这三种数据抓取的方法实现数据抓取...

介绍python中slice参数过长的处理方法及实例【代码】【图】

python教程栏目介绍slice参数过长的处理方法很多小伙伴对于slice参数的概念理解停留在概念上,切片的参数有三个,分别是step 、start 、stop 。因为参数的值也是多变的,所以我们需要对它们进行下一步的处理。在之前的slice讲解中我们提到列表数据过长的问题,其中在参数中也有这样的问题存在。下面我们就step 、start 、stop 三个参数的分别处理展开讲解,帮大家深入了解slice中的参数问题。相关免费学习推荐:python教程(视频)...

Python定时任务,实现自动化的方法【代码】【图】

python教程栏目介绍实现自动化的方法。1. 安装cron基本上所有的Linux发行版在默认情况下都预安装了cron工具。即使未预装cron,也很简单,执行几条简单的命令就可手动安装# 检查是否已经预装了cron service cron status复制代码安装并启动服务安装:apt-get install cron 启动/停止/重启:service cron start/stop/restart 查询当前任务:crontab -l复制代码2. 安装检查安装完成后检查一下是否安装成功,同样使用 status命令查看出现...

Python定时任务,实现自动化的方法【代码】【图】

python教程栏目介绍实现自动化的方法。1. 安装cron基本上所有的Linux发行版在默认情况下都预安装了cron工具。即使未预装cron,也很简单,执行几条简单的命令就可手动安装# 检查是否已经预装了cron service cron status复制代码安装并启动服务安装:apt-get install cron 启动/停止/重启:service cron start/stop/restart 查询当前任务:crontab -l复制代码2. 安装检查安装完成后检查一下是否安装成功,同样使用 status命令查看出现...

总结用Python 操作 PDF 的几种方法【代码】【图】

python教程栏目今天为大家总结用Python操作PDF的几种方法。01前言大家好,有关 Python 操作 PDF 的案例之前已经写过一个?PDF批量合并,这个案例初衷只是给大家提供一个便利的脚本,并没有太多讲解原理,其中涉及的就是 PDF 处理很实用的模块 PyPDF2 ,本文就好好剖析一下这个模块,主要将涉及os 模块综合应用glob 模块综合应用PyPDF2 模块操作02基本操作PyPDF2 导入模块的代码常常是:from PyPDF2 import PdfFileReader, PdfFileWri...

pandas技巧之 详解DataFrame中的apply与applymap方法【图】

相关学习推荐:python视频教程今天是pandas数据处理专题的第5篇文章,我们来聊聊pandas的一些高级运算。在上一篇文章当中,我们介绍了panads的一些计算方法,比如两个dataframe的四则运算,以及dataframe填充Null的方法。今天这篇文章我们来聊聊dataframe中的广播机制,以及apply函数的使用方法。 dataframe广播 广播机制我们其实并不陌生, 我们在之前介绍numpy的专题文章当中曾经介绍过广播。当我们对两个尺寸不一致的数组进行运...

pandas技巧之 DataFrame中的排序与汇总方法【图】

相关学习推荐:python教程今天是pandas数据处理专题的第六篇文章,我们来聊聊DataFrame的排序与汇总运算。在上一篇文章当中我们主要介绍了DataFrame当中的apply方法,如何在一个DataFrame对每一行或者是每一列进行广播运算,使得我们可以在很短的时间内处理整份数据。今天我们来聊聊如何对一个DataFrame根据我们的需要进行排序以及一些汇总运算的使用方法。 排序 排序是我们一个非常基本的需求,在pandas当中将这个需求进一步细分,...

Python照片合成的方法详解【代码】【图】

【相关学习推荐:python教程】文章目录前言Github效果实现过程整体代码前言看电影的时候发现一个照片墙的功能,觉得这样生成照片挺好玩的,于是就动手用Python做了一下,觉得用来作照片纪念的效果可能会不错。P:后面了解到我想做的功能叫蒙太奇拼图,所以这篇博客记录先留着,闲下来会去看一下蒙太奇拼图的算法Githubhttps://github.com/jiandi1027/photo.git效果实现过程1.获取图片文件夹的图片个数N,将底图拆分成XY块区域,且使...

Python爬取51cto数据并存入MySQL方法详解【代码】【图】

【相关学习推荐:python教程】实验环境1.安装Python 3.72.安装requests, bs4,pymysql 模块实验步骤1.安装环境及模块可参考https://www.jb51.net/article/194104.htm2.编写代码# 51cto 博客页面数据插入mysql数据库 # 导入模块 import re import bs4 import pymysql import requests# 连接数据库账号密码 db = pymysql.connect(host=172.171.13.229,user=root, passwd=abc123,db=test, port=3306,charset=utf8) # 获取游标 cursor ...